## TL;DR

This paper explores how Troglitazone protects nerves from epilepsy-related injury by inhibiting a process called ferroptosis.

## Contribution

The study reveals a novel protective mechanism of Troglitazone against epilepsy-induced nerve damage through ferroptosis inhibition.

## Key findings

- Troglitazone was found to inhibit ferroptosis in epilepsy-induced nerve injury.
- The protective effect of Troglitazone was confirmed through experimental models of epilepsy.
- This research provides new insights into potential therapeutic strategies for epilepsy-related nerve damage.
